Emily & Dan’s reception took place at Welch Field in Montreat, so the bride, groom, and guests simply walked to their reception location while the sounds of bag pipes drifted through the mountains.

There were games set up in the field for the guests to play, as well as standing-height tables lit by mason jar candles outside the tent to lure people outside as the sun set.

Hors d’oeuvres were served before dinner and guests were encouraged to find their seats according to a chalkboard seating chart and names painted on pieces of slate.

I loved this idea! Weddings guests wrote messages to the bride & groom on pieces of smooth river rock.

Here are just a few more of the details that added to the rustic charm of the reception, which was handled by Jennifer King from Verge Events and catered by The Colorful Palate.
